An edited volume devoted to the reception and reputation of Edinburgh's premier Enlightenment portrait painter.Sir Henry Raeburn (1756-1823) is especially well known in Scotland as the portrait painter of members of the Scottish Enlightenment. However, outside Scotland, the artist rarely makes more than a fleeting appearance in survey books about portraiture. A review of the most recent exhibition devoted to the artist held in Edinburgh and London during 1997/8, noted that it wears the aspect of a closure rather than a new dawn' in Raeburn studies, with the painter being shown 'in solitary splendour'.This volume seeks to recover Raeburn from his artistic isolation by looking at his local and international reception and reputation, both in his lifetime and posthumously. It focuses as much on Edinburgh and Scotland as on metropolitan markets and cosmopolitan contexts. Sir Henry Raeburn (1756-1823) is one of the most universally admired and best loved of all Scottish painters. His work defines the society of which he himself was such a distinguished part. Through his eyes we still see those who graced the social and intellectual world of Scotland in the later years of the Scottish Enlightenment. Redolent of the world which Raeburn painted are the dramatic portraits of judges, like the crotchety Lord Eldin and the eloquent Lord Newton, the writer Sir Walter Scott, and the geologist James Hutton. But Raeburn had a gentler, more domestic side, as typified by the profound and touching sentiment of the double portrait of Sir John and Lady Clerk of Penicuik and his appealing portraits of children. Together with the portrait of the skating minister Reverend Robert Walker, arguably now one of the most famous paintings in the world, his paintings light up a whole society in a way that is unparalleled.

Portraiture, indeed, is probably the most popular, being certainly the most 'interesting, ' of all the departments of painting; and from Holbein downwards through the centuries, its practitioners amongst us have lacked neither oppor tunity nor recognition in their lives, and in their deaths have been remembered and esteemed with an enthusiasm sometimes wholly dispr0portionate to their deserts. For one or another reason Romney commands a higher price than Van Dyck, unless Van Dyck be at his very best; while you could furnish a gallery with Lelys and Knellers, and have something over to spend in Raeburns, for the cost of a single Gainsborough. This, of course, is fame - fame of a kind; but the fame of Raeburn is far other in type, and rests on very different grounds. He has neither Romney's sentiment' nor Gainsborough's charm his achievement is largely wanting in that purely personal' quality so dear to the British mind, and is touched with scarce a vestige of that imperfect, or 'wholly individual', craftsmanship so near to the British heart. It is sane in ambition, severe in style, distinguished in method, nothing if not artistic in effect. For all such qualities as 'latent poetry of suggestiveness', as 'exquisite yet lofty subjee tivity', as passionate yet almost morbific subtlety of vision and realization - for them and their like, I say, you must look elsewhere than here.
